description
Charnwood Borough Council wishes to enter into a contract with a catering organisation that will provide a consistent, high quality and cost effective service to visitors, customers and officials from the Queens Park Café located within Charnwood Museum, which is situated in Queens Park, Loughborough.
The basis of the proposed contract is to receive a guaranteed rent from the Supplier who will earn their income from profits achieved above and beyond this rent and other agreed cost payable to the Council, which include utilities, telephone and waste/refuse collection.
Queens Park Café is housed within a Victorian building which was originally the town swimming baths, and is now Charnwood Museum. The café can seat a maximum of 50 people inside and includes an outside terrace which can be utilised in the summer and in fair weather. The terrace is well positioned with attractive views of the park and buildings.
The Cafe can be open both in conjunction with and independently of the Museum.
